2021-01-14

WIN7-L2TP/IPSec 访问网站连接被重置-错误809的解决办法

作者 admin

【如何添加注册表:复制下面代码到txt文档, 将后缀改为.reg,双击注册】

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\RasMan\Parameters]
"ProhibitIpSec"=dword:00000000

就直接809报错了。又继续查找,要添加一个注册表的项:

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\PolicyAgent]
"AssumeUDPEncapsulationContextOnSendRule"=dword:00000002

依然不行。奇怪了啊,后来在http://www.enet.com.cn/article/2010/0928/A20100928741487.shtml发现有三个服务需要启动(“Remote Access Auto Connection Manager”、“Remote Access Connection Manager”和“Secure Socket Tunneling Protocol Service”),一检查,其中我的“Remote Access Auto Connection Manager”服务是手动的,并未启动,改成自动启动后再连接L2TP/IPSec的VPN,发现一切正常了,访问外网也OK了。

至此,问题解决。

总结了一下:除了要修改上面两个注册表外(因为我设置了ipsec的密钥,没有密钥用L2TP就失去意义了),剩下的就是把三个服务都要自动启动好就可以正常使用了

然后重启 就链接好了。

之前设置win10也是需要注册表。和服务设置。当时看有人说win7没有这么麻烦。看来都差不多哈。都得设置。都得重启电脑。局域网也可以用vpn链接。实践出真知。

局域网vpn和不用vpn速度对比 图

有vpn

局域网直连

局域网下差别很小。千分之五以内的差别。L2TP速度还行。下次在远程测试下。